| Accelerate 1588/PTP and TSN Testing with UNH-IOL vIOLett® Software | Bob Noseworthy & Daroc Alden |
vIOLett® is a family of software packages used to test a product’s conformance to common protocols used in Time Sensitive Networking (TSN). There are vIOLett packages to test 1588, including Telecom and Power Profile, gPTP, MRP, MSRP, MVRP, and CBS. In addition, vIOLett is used to test products for the Avnu Certification Program, including Bridges, Pro AV or Milan Endstations, and Automotive devices. Learn how this tool can help identify areas of improvement during the development process and automate testing, reducing time to market and increasing your product’s reliability. In this presentation, industry experts, Bob Noseworthy and Daroc Alden, UNH-IOL, will review key features of vIOLett and what it means for your TSN testing. |

| NIST TN1337: Characterization of Clocks and Oscillators | D.B. Sullivan, D.W. Allan, DA. Howe, F.L. Walls |
This is a collection of published papers assembled as a reference for those involved in characterizing and specifying high-performance clocks and oscillators. It is an interim replacement for NBS Monograph 140, Time and Frequency: Theory and Fundamentals, an older volume of papers edited by Byron E. Blair. This current volume includes tutorial papers, papers on standards and definitions, and a collection of papers detailing specific measurement and analysis techniques. The discussion in the introduction to the volume provides a guide to the content of the papers, and tables and graphs provide further help in organizing methods described in the papers |

| FQTSS Overview | William Gravelle |
FQTSS is defined in the IEEE standard 801.Q Clause 34; Forwarding and Queuing Enhancements for Time-Sensitive Streams. The term FQTSS is used to describe a set of tools which are used to forward and queue time-sensitive streams. Since AVB frames cannot be dropped, there must be a mechanism in place to forward AVB frames quickly and efficiently. This is where FQTSS (aka Qav) comes into play. This paper goes into the components that make up FQTSS. |
